Predator Jacks

Full Body, Cardio

- This movement and tempo is similar to your standard Jumping Jacks or In and Out Squats, however we are now getting a wide deep squat to activate our legs even more.
- As we jump out, we do a deep squat, our chest stays up, and our arms open wide.
- To get a wide squat, we can turn our toes outward, however be careful to not let your knees bow inward. They should be following the line of your toes.
- As we jump, always remember to land softly through the balls of your feet.
- As we squat, we then want to transfer the pressure to our mid-feet or heels.
- To avoid hunching, do not look down at your toes.
